<p>Both users and developers of Twitter’s third-party clients were surprised last week when many popular apps like Tweetbot stopped working out of the blue. Since then, <a href="https://9to5mac.com/2023/01/13/tweetbot-twitter-apps-still-broken-elon-musk-api/" target="_blank" rel="noreferrer noopener">not even Twitter or its new owner Elon Musk[/url] (who likes to talk a lot on the social network) have addressed this issue. Today, Twitter continues to disrespect developers, this time with a weak explanation of what’s going on with its API.</p>
